Red de conocimiento informático - Problemas con los teléfonos móviles - python3 explica qué significa si __name__=="__main__":? Como se muestra a continuación

python3 explica qué significa si __name__=="__main__":? Como se muestra a continuación

if?__main__":?#Si el script de ejecución principal ejecuta el siguiente código, se llamará directamente desde la línea de comando en lugar de ser importado y llamado por otros scripts

import?sys?#Importar módulo sys

p>

fib(int(sys.argv[1]))?#Respondí en otra pregunta tuya: sys.argv guarda los parámetros de la línea de comando, argv[0] es el nombre del script (fibo .py), argv[1] es el primer parámetro (1), el int se convierte en un int porque obtiene una cadena

Si resuelve su problema, ¡úselo!

Si el problema no se resuelve, continúe con el seguimiento